Shrine Bowl of the Carolina’s 2016 Player Selection Release
North and South Carolina Shrine Bowl Coaches will gather at the Oasis Shrine Center 604 Doug Mayes Place in Charlotte on Monday September 26th at 2PM for the selection announcement of the 88 players from the more than 400 name submissions from the two Carolinas.
Ron Long, Athletic Director of the Shrine Bowl said, “Tar Heel Head Coach David Gentry of Murphy High School in Murphy, North Carolina and Sandlapper Head Coach Phil Strickland of Newberry High School in Newberry, South Carolina along with their respective coaching staffs will select 44 players each, in what they termed would well represent their respective states. This final selection process culminates nearly a year of extraordinary work that these coaching staffs’ dedicate to the selection process in addition to their regular jobs.”
Earlier today, Jamie Smith, General Game Chairman and Connie Altman, Chairman of The Shrine Bowl Board of Governors announced that the Shrine Bowl of the Carolina’s Web site and GoUpstate.com will present a live Internet Webcast that will include the Shrine Bowl Player Selection Rosters for 2016. Members of the Press are invited to attend and fully participate in the Press Conference. The Press Conference/Webcast is slated to begin at 2PM on Monday, September 26th, 2016.
To access this live presentation, members of the press not present and other interested parties may watch the official release as Tar Heel Head Coach David Gentry of Murphy, and Sandlapper Head Coach Phil Strickland of Newberry, preview the 80th game and talk with members of the press that are present regarding the players chosen to participate in this all start classic, along with quotes useable for stories, and the 2016 roster of players for both teams.
